2014 Catalogue Launch - Swing Card 4

Stampin' Up! Swing card thinlit dies have been so very popular.  Now we are punching out the centre and featuring a hanging piece...flowers, butterflies, hearts, Christmas trees... the sky is the limit.

These are examples I created to showcase the versatility of what can be a centre piece.

Decorated in Stampin' Up! DSP, The scallop flower is the centre point for this birthday card.
A closer look shows the layering of the 2014-15 in-colours in the flower piece, and the structure.
The flower is simply created by layering the different colours of the scallop circle punched out card stock...

The colours used in this creation include Hello Honey, Tangelo Twist and Pink Pirouette.
I then test the waters for Christmas and combined Hello Honey and Lost Lagoon to make a lovely 3D Christmas tree, which is comprised of four (4) punched out triangles...
The Stampin' Up! DSP is mounted on Smokey Slate.
The tree was made using the Stampin' Up! punch Petite Pennants Builder 122361...

Christmas Card 12

Stampin up have many fantastic products and the stamp set Pennant Parade (W125012 / 122742) is one of those.  It is so versatile in that it can be used in banners, flags and of course Christmas Trees.  I made this card last year, to demonstrate when you cannot choose between the punch (Petite Pennants Builder 112361) and stamp set, one should probably purchase the punch first because it can be decorated with anything, in this case Dasher's (retired ) antlers and the tree from Contempo Christmas (retired).  This is a very simple layout but stunning...

The base card stock (also used on the trees) is Lucky Limade, dressed with Confetti Cream spritzed with gold smooch and embossed with Embossing Folder Vintage Wall Paper (120175).  The bottom panel is poppy parade - a lovely contrast to the cream and green I thought.  The wonderful verse is from the Contempo Christmas Stamp Set.  The trees are topped with SU Rhinestones.
 From a different angle so you can see I've set the trees and greeting up on Stampin' Up! Dimensionals...
A Crafty Cat; Stampin' Up! Petite Pennants for Christmas
The trees can be replaced with trees from the Scentsational Season or Ornament Keepsakes Set with corresponding framelit dies, or images from the Delightful Decorations (W121502 / C127787)with the coordinating Ornament Punch (119847) could easily be used and decorated instead of my simple trees.
